realme 12 Pro and 12 Pro + launched in India | Know Features, Price, Sale
Tumblr media
realme has launched the realme 12 Pro and 12 Pro+ smartphones in the realme 12 series in India, as it had promised. These have a 6.7-inch FHD+ 120Hz curved AMOLED with ultra narrow bezels and 2160Hz PWM ultra-high frequency dimming, same as the 11 Pro series.
The phones also feature ProXDR that analyzes the image content transmitted by the camera, optimizing photo effects for a complete range of brightness and dynamic range.

The realme 12 Pro is powered by Snapdragon 6 Gen 1 SoC and the 12 Pro+ is powered by Snapdragon 7s Gen 2 SoC. These pack up to 12 GB of RAM with up to 12 GB of RAM expansion. The phones feature 3D VC Cooling system with 3394mm² vapor chamber in the 12 Pro+.
The phones run Android 14 with realme UI 5.0 out of the box, and should get 2 Android OS updates and 3 years of security updates, similar to the previous Pro series phones.
Tumblr media
The realme 12 Pro+ has a 50MP rear camera with Sony IMX890 sensor with OIS. It has a 64MP Omnivision OV64B periscope telephoto camera with OIS offering 3x optical zoom, 6x in-sensor zoom, and the phone supports up to 120x SuperZoom. The realme 12 Pro has a 50MP IMX882 sensor with OIS, but this has a 32MP portrait camera. Both the phones feature a 8MP ultra-wide camera.
The phones feature a luxury watch design, for which it has partnered with Luxury Watch Designer Ollivier Savéo. The phone has a premium design experience previously exclusive to luxury timepieces, said the company. It has a vegan leather finish.
Collaborating with Qualcomm, it has enhanced image processing with the MasterShot Algorithm. The realme 12 Pro Series is the first and only device in its segment to process RAW domains, ensuring top clarity, dynamic range, and realism in cinematic portraits, the company added.
Both the phones pack a 5000mAh battery with 67W SuperVOOC fast charging that can charge the phone up to 50% in 19 minutes and 100% in 48 minutes.

The realme 12 Pro and 12 Pro+ come in Submarine Blue and Navigator Beige colours and the 12 Pro+ also comes in India-exclusive Explorer Red version which will be available from February 9th, just in time for the Valentine’s Day.
The realme 12 Pro is priced at Rs. 25,999 for the 8GB + 128GB model and the 8GB + 256GB costs Rs. 26,999.
The realme 12 Pro+ is priced at Rs. 29,999 for the 8GB + 128GB model, Rs. 31,999 for the 8GB + 256GB model and the top-end 12GB + 256GB model costs Rs. 33,999.
These will be available from realme.com, Flipkart and offline stores from February 6th. There is an early access sale from 6 to 8PM today, January 29th across these online channels and also through offline channels.

What's New Features in Android 14
Tumblr media
Google's Android 14 beta programme is well underway, with the main release scheduled for the end of summer 2023. We're now looking at Android 14 Beta 4, which is the most recent available update. We're still at least a month away from the final version, and in the meanwhile, there are a slew of new features to sift through and explore before the stable version arrives on all the latest and best Android phones. If you want a complete list of what's new and what to anticipate in Android 14, keep reading - there's a lot, and it's definitely a bigger version than Android 13, though it still doesn't compare to Android 12, which offered Google entire new features. Android 14's Easter egg is finally here Every Android version contains a hidden Easter egg in the system settings, and Android 14 is no exception. The Easter egg has you launch a rocket, soaring across the wide nothingness of space with the chance to explore stars, planets, and more, in keeping with the Apollo 14-inspired logo for this edition. It's a fun little mini-game that you should certainly try out if you have Android 14.
Tumblr media
You may access it, like in previous releases, by opening system settings, going to About phone Android version, and repeatedly and rapidly clicking the Android version entry. Then, long-press the Android 14 logo for a few seconds to launch the rocket, which includes haptic stimulation. Android 14 Beta 4 makes PIN entry slightly faster Many Android phones allow you to unlock your handset instantaneously by entering the right PIN without needing to press an additional enter button. Google has finally added this functionality to Pixel phones. When you have a PIN with six numbers or more, an option to turn on Auto-confirm unlock appears in system settings under Security & privacy Device unlock screen lock cog. The option is checked by default when you create a six-digit PIN, but you may uncheck it if you want not to reveal a burglar how many digits your PIN contains. When you enable the change, you will see outlines on your PIN entering page indicating how many numbers you need to write, and the enter button in the keyboard will be removed. As you press the keys, the outlines fill in. When you input an incorrect digit on the last outline, the entry area clears instantaneously, forcing you to completely repeat your PIN. Android 14 adds new default profile images If you share your device with many individuals (as may be the situation with the Pixel Tablet), you must switch between various profiles. You may either use your own photos or rely on Android 14's slick new selection of preset graphics, which was discovered by Mishaal Rahman. Android 14 Beta 4 brings home screen customization to older Pixel phones Prior to the Pixel 6, home screen customization capabilities, like as the ability to pick different lock screen shortcuts or clocks, were inexplicably lacking from Pixel phones. Several owners verified in Mishaal Rahman's Twitter thread that they may now do so using Android 14 Beta 4. Android 14 makes your lock screen customizable Apple's iOS 16 allows extremely customised lock screens, and it seemed obvious that Google would have to respond at some time. That's the situation with Android 14. In Android 14 Beta 3, the business allows you to replace the default lock screen clock with a number of other options. Furthermore, you may select a more complicated interface that reorganises the other info on your lock screen, such as the current weather conditions and date. Surprisingly, Mishaal Rahman says that the personalization choices are unavailable on the Pixel 4a 5G and Pixel 5. We can only hope that this is a glitch. If you don't want home automation or Google Wallet, you'll be able to switch to various fast action buttons at the bottom with Android 14. You may choose whether to easily access the QR code scanner, torch, Do Not Disturb or Mute, photo or video camera or nothing at all for a cleaner appearance. To activate the activities, you must now long-press the buttons, much as on iOS. In terms of parallels, you can reach the personalization choices by long-pressing the home screen, something Apple added to its operating system a time back. Android 14 brings back the clock shortcut in the notification
Tumblr media
Google loves to change the notification shade with each Android release, and Android 14 is no exception. The clock in the upper left corner has been turned into a tappable portion, allowing you to instantly access the Clock app without cluttering your home screen with yet another icon or widget. The feature appears and disappears in Android, and it was last deleted in Android 12 after being present on Pixel phones in Android 11. Android 14 gets a new mouse cursor Android 14 Beta 3 includes a new mouse pointer that appears a lot more contemporary and distinct than the existing Mac-like version, as observed by Tasker developer Joo Dias (via Mishaal Rahman). The new form resembles a triangle rather than a pointer, but it is still clear what function it serves. With Google's renewed interest in tablets and rumours of a Pro version of the Pixel Tablets circulating, it's understandable that it would want to refine productivity tools like these.
